Improper Sizing of Heat Pump



When it comes to the installment of heat pumps, one of the most common errors is improperly sizing the device for your space. Making sure the appropriate dimension is vital for optimum performance. If the heat pump is too little, it will certainly struggle to heat or cool your space efficiently, leading to enhanced power bills and potential deterioration on the unit.



On the other hand, if the heatpump is too huge, it will certainly cycle on and off frequently, causing temperature fluctuations and minimizing its life expectancy.

To prevent this blunder, it's vital to have a specialist evaluate your room and recommend the suitable size of the heatpump based on variables like square footage, insulation, ceiling height, and neighborhood climate. By spending the time and effort to make sure the appropriate sizing, you can enjoy a comfortable atmosphere while maximizing energy efficiency and lengthening the life-span of your heatpump.

Inadequate Insulation and Sealing



To make sure the reliable operation of your heat pump, it's important to deal with insufficient insulation and sealing in your space. Proper insulation aids preserve a constant temperature inside, reducing the workload on your heatpump. Poor insulation can lead to energy loss, making your heat pump work harder and much less effectively.

Securing any kind of spaces or leaks in your room is equally important. These voids allow conditioned air to leave and outside air to permeate in, requiring your heat pump to compensate for the temperature level fluctuations.

Wrong Positioning of Outdoor System



Dealing with the placement of your heatpump's exterior system is essential to optimizing its efficiency. Installing the outside device in a wrong area can result in effectiveness problems and potential damages to the device.

One usual mistake to avoid is placing the outdoor system too near a wall surface or various other frameworks. This can limit airflow, causing the unit to function more difficult to warm or cool your area, inevitably lowering its performance and lifespan.

One more mistake to steer clear of is placing the outdoor unit in straight sunlight. While some sunshine is inescapable, excessive exposure can result in getting too hot, especially throughout hot summer days. It's ideal to position the exterior unit in a shaded location to assist keep its ideal operating temperature level.
